Job summary
Exciting opportunity for a Salaried GP at well-established and forward thinking training practice in Coventry.
Practice information
17,000 list size across our 4 sites
Teaching & Training practice
3 GP Partners, Physicians associates -Full nursing support team including: ANPs, ACPs, NA's, HCAs, Practice Nurses, Clinical prescribing pharmacists .
We Host a large variety of specialist clinics including (Minor surgery, joint injections, family planning, women's health and more)
System-EMIS Clinical System - Docman- Accurx

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).
From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
